Usage:
The “radio receiver GPS-time - KNX can send the following
data to the KNX bus: Time standard / Geographical position /
The course of the angle of solar radiation during the day /
Sunrise and sunset times / Outside temperature / Lux values
Please note:
During polar nights and days in the polar region the values of
the sun angle are fixed as follows:
=> Elevation angle = 0°
=> Azimuth = Northern Hemisphere Azimuth South /
Southern Hemisphere Azimuth North
Technical data
Power Supply:
via KNX bus voltage (nominal voltage 29V)
Bus current:
approx. 10 mA
Bus system:
KNX
Type of protection:
IP 54 (DIN EN 60529)
Permitted ambient temperature:
-30°C 5C
Specifications // Compliance:
EN 60730 // CE
Housing:
self-extinguishing thermoplast
Assembly:
wall mounting with mounting bracket
Type of connection:
KNX bus terminal

Installation instruction
Make sure that the GPS time receiver (top of the device) has free view to sky. Trees, walls, and so on, can severely degrade the satellite reception capability of the receiver.
Make sure that there are no transformers, relays, switches, or similar devices within a radius of one meter around the GPS time receiver.
If mounted on wall, avoid electric cables and other disturbing metal in the wall.
If the GPS-LED on the bottom side of the device is NOT flashing: Check proper connection
If the GPS-LED on the bottom side of the device is flashing fast (5 Hz): Connection OK / device is waiting for GPS signal (can take up to 15 minutes)
If the GPS-LED on the bottom side of the device is flashing slow (1 Hz): Connection OK / GPS signal OK
If the GPS-LED on the bottom side of the device is flashing fast longer than 15 minutes (5 Hz): Possibly no GPS signal. Try to use an alternative position.
Installation and connection of the device
Connection / wall mounting
Remove both screws on the bottom side and remove the bottom cover.
Guide wire through the cable sleeve and the hole of the bottom cover.
Connect the wire to the removable BUS terminal block (Please note polarity).
Plug BUS terminal block to pins on PCB
RESULT => After proper connection the GPS-LED is flashing
Program the radio receiver (please see point Configuration radio receiver).
Assemble cable sleeve on the bottom cover.
Screw the bottom cover.
Install wall mounting bracket and attach GPS time receiver (see drilling plan).
Configuration radio receiver
The parameterization will be assigned by the ETS-software: Physical address, group address, parameter settings
Programming the radio receiver
Press the learning key
RESULT => The KNX-LED lights up (until the ETS-software programs the radio receiver)
PLEASE NOTE => You can confirm the correct programming with the ETS-software
